Lookify credits are the currency that powers phone number lookups on the website and through the Lookify API. This article focuses on how credits apply to searches on lookify.io; for API request types and data objects, use the documentation link at the end of this page.
Credits are the units used to unlock deeper data after a free preview. Each paid search type on the web costs a fixed number of credits so you can choose the depth of lookup you need.
There are four search types when you want to go beyond the free preview: Carrier, Threat, Person Lite, and Person Pro. You choose the search type that fits the types of data you want to retrieve. For example, a Person Lite search will return the core identity data including full name, current mailing address, associated people and addresses, and caller type. A Threat search will return the Lookify Threat Score, including burner detection. The table below shows the credit cost and what each option usually includes.

| Search type | Credit Cost | What's included & typical fields |
|---|---|---|
Free preview | 0 | No credits are used. You see a preview of the number with formatted digits and line type, a high-level carrier and location summary, and hints about what paid sections could show. Those sections stay locked until you run a paid search. |
Carrier | 1 | Unlocks carrier data only. Person and threat sections are not included with this option.
|
Threat | 2 | Unlocks threat (risk) data only, including the threat score area of the report. Person and carrier sections are not fully unlocked beyond what the free preview already shows.
|
PersonLite | 10 | One search unlocks the Person (Lite), Carrier, and Threat sections together. You get core identity and address data plus carrier and threat detail comparable to running standalone Carrier and Threat searches for the same number, in a single bundled lookup.
|
PersonPro | 30 | This is the full stack for the number: everything in Person Lite (person, carrier, and threat), plus Pro profile-style fields when available—employment, education, alternate emails and phone numbers, and social or professional profiles.
|
